Hey raccoonator this team seems fun but non-Stealth Rock Krookodile is a liability and you currently do not have any hazards at all. "Overload" type concepts are best on hyper offense when using too many Pokemon with not a lot of defensive utility. There is also a lack of speed control that can make opposing offensive teams scary. To keep the team based around the Krookodile-Gyara-Bulu core a more offensive route felt best.

Major Changes
:slowking: ->:necrozma:
Necrozma @ Power Herb
Ability: Prism Armor
EVs: 4 HP /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
Modest Nature
- Meteor Beam
- Photon Geyser
- Heat Wave
- Stealth Rock
Hazards are needed for every team. Even in Sword and Shield games where you can run into teams where half the team is running Heavy-Duty Boots hazards make a solid amount of progress in longer games. Stealth Rock has uses against more offensive teams too, like chunking Darmanitan on Sun and breaking focus sashes. Necrozma beats a fair amount of hazard removal and is able to keep them up decently. Its inclusion also gives you a more reliable means of pressuring Skarmory teams.

Nidoking and Tentacruel are already relatively niche Pokemon and do not really fit onto super offensive structures at the same time. You already have an Electric-immunity in Krookodile and plenty of breaking power so Nidoking seemed to not contribute much. Tentacruel has removal that is not necessary on hyper offense. To round out the team Galarian Slowbro and Scizor have been best. Slowbro is able to cheese wins with its solid coverage options. Scizor is a menace at +2 and fills the role of a missing Steel-type for this squad-- adding a fair amount of defensive utility with additional setup opportunities.
